Christmas cards in mother tongue

The project will take the form of a classic Christmas card exchange, with the only difference being that the cards will be written in English and translated into the mother tongue of the participants. When schools receive Christmas cards, they make funny videos where students try to wish a happy Christmas in all the languages in which they received the wishes. The short videos are then uploaded to Twinspace and released at some of the pre-Christmas hours.
